International Shipping
If you are planning to have your order shipped to a United States address with the intention of forwarding it to your home country, we strongly encourage you to reconsider and ship directly to your home country instead. While international shipping rates are often higher than domestic U.S. rates, bypassing the United States is almost always the more cost-effective choice for our international customers at the moment.
The primary reason for this is because of the United States import tariff/duties. Shipments entering the U.S. are subject to significant duties, reaching approximately 30% of the subtotal which are collected upon checkout from our store. By shipping directly to your country, you avoid these unnecessary U.S. based costs entirely. Even if your home country imposes its own import duties, these are typically much lower than the fees you would incur by routing your package through the U.S. first.
For smaller items under $100 USD, the difference in total cost may be negligible. However, if your order sub-total exceeds $$200 USD, these accumulated U.S. tariffs can become quite substantial. Shipping directly to your country ensures you pay only the necessary international postage and your own local taxes, preventing you from paying a premium to "import" the item twice.
